Thank you eWhisper that helps. I still don't know whether a conversion is recorded on the day of the sale or on the day the ad was clicked.

If an ad is clicked on Monday but the purchase didn't happen til Friday. Will the conversion show up in Monday or Friday's stats?

The last info I saw, the action is attributed to the day of the click - not the day of the action.
